About the Item

Elaborate silver and mother-of-pearl, silver plate flatware set. Original box with shield crest and fittings and was originally commissioned by The Earl of Tankerville of Chillington. It is comprised of 12 forks, 12 knives, two nut crackers, two nut picks, fruit scissors, two berry spoons and a large carving knife. This set is truly exquisite and from another time. This would have been used when dining was an art and one would have a course of fruit and nuts. England, Circa 1850

Alan Adler Sterling Silver Walnut Modernist Hand Wrought Serving Coffee Set
Located in New York, NY
This elegant sterling silver and walnut coffee set was realized by the legendary designer Allan Adler in the United States circa 1950. The set features a coffee pot, sugar bowl and spoon, and creamer. Created in sterling silver, this set showcases Allan Adler's signature aesthetic- a kind of traditional modernism applying a pared down minimalist perspective to classical design elements. Here the silhouettes of the pieces look traditional but feature idiosyncratic details that clearly indicate their modernism- as fresh looking today as when it was made. The hand rubbed walnut handles are hewn in an amorphic shape that flares asymmetrically at its end. It is inescapably a modern form. It is pared, however, with historical language (from Art Nouveau for instance) that roots the pieces in a more traditionalist place. They feature stylized vine motifs on the finial of the coffee pot top and leaf motifs that trace the circular bases. The protuberant bodies created in lustrous sterling salver taper at each end. This is an outstanding example of Adler's practice that represents his inimitable aesthetic at its very best. It is sure to delight collectors of his work, as well as those with a penchant for beautifully crafted and special objects. It is signed "Adler Sterling" on the base and is in excellent vintage condition. Adler began his career as an apprentice in 1938, designing silverware and inspired by the design of the early 1900s specifically Art Nouveau. His name became associated with Hollywood glamour in the early 1940s. he was commissioned to design mini-Oscars for Academy Award winners, crowns for Miss Universe and Miss USA, and silver bowls and candlesticks for celebrities and dignitaries.
